Definitions:

Utility

In economics, the total satisfaction received from consuming a good or service.

Entrepreneur

An individual who starts, organizes, manages, and assumes the risks of a business or enterprise, often innovating and creating new products, services, or business models.

Market Demand

The total quantity of a good or service that all consumers in a market are willing and able to buy at different price levels, over a specific time period.

Economic Resource

An asset used to produce goods and services that can provide economic benefit.
